Special Editors: Lane Hudgins, Thomas Ireland, and Gerald Martin
This will be the first in a series of features on "Reviews and Cases of Note" in the Journal of Legal Economics that will focus on reviews of legal decisions, case studies and articles of interest to forensic economics that may have appeared in media that forensic economists do not typically read. The papers will not present original research in the sense usually required for double-blind editorial review. It must be written well enough to satisfy members of the editorial board of the journal, but reviews of this kind should not be claimed as "peer reviewed publications."
